Understanding The 3-Speed 090 Transmission

The 3-speed 090 automatic transmission was standard in VW T3 and Vanagon models produced between 1983 and 1991. Known for its reliability, this transmission is simple yet effective making it a favourite among enthusiasts.

This transmission includes a stock differential final drive ratio of 4.09:1 providing a good balance between power and efficiency.

However, the beauty of this rebuilt transmission lies in its versatility. You can customize it with aftermarket final drive ratios to better suit your driving needs. Specialised Parts has available ratios include 3.27:1, 3.72:1, and 4.45:1, each offering a different driving experience.

Tailored Final Drive Ratios For A Customized Experience

The stock final drive ratio of 4.09:1 offers a great balance but you may want a different ratio depending on your driving style. For better fuel economy, a 3.27:1 ratio might be the ideal choice.

If you need more torque for hilly terrains or towing, a 4.45:1 ratio would suit you better. With these options, you can tailor your van’s performance to match your lifestyle.

What Is The 5EAT 2WD Conversion Kit?

The 5EAT 2WD Conversion Kit is a specialized product created to modify Subaru’s AWD system, specifically the 5EAT automatic transmission for use as a 2WD transmission in mid-engine vehicles.

This kit includes all the essential parts required for the conversion, such as:

  • Large back cover plate with mounting holes
  • Output shaft
  • Output gear
  • Mounting bracket with bolts
  • Thrust bearing retaining ring plate
  • A pair of Subaru OEM stub axle shafts
  • A pair of 100mm standard-length axle flanges

This conversion kit retains the same rotation as the original setup. It ensures that it maintains compatibility with the output axles while converting the drivetrain to power just two wheels instead of all four.

Standard Oil Pans: The Basics

A standard oil pan is designed for stock engines under typical driving conditions. For the Subaru EJ series, the stock oil pan has a capacity of 4.2 litres and a height of 168 mm.

While this setup works perfectly well for daily commutes or moderate driving, it might not be ideal for modified or high-performance engines.

Here are some common characteristics of a standard oil pan:

  • Lower oil capacity: Usually holds enough oil for standard use, but may struggle to keep up with increased demands.
  • Standard ground clearance: Typically, standard oil pans do not prioritize ground clearance, which could be a concern for lowered or modified vehicles.
  • Basic construction: The materials and design of a standard oil pan are functional, but not optimized for high-performance needs.

While the stock oil pan gets the job done for unmodified engines, vehicle conversions or engines pushed beyond factory limits require something more robust.

High-Capacity Oil Pans: Enhanced Features

Now, let’s explore the high-capacity oil pans, specifically designed for the Subaru EJ series engines. These pans are engineered to support modified vehicles and maintain consistent oil pressure under heavy loads.

Increased Oil Capacity

A high-capacity oil pan significantly increases the amount of oil that can be stored and circulated through the engine. For instance:

Option 1: Increased Ground Clearance High Capacity Oil Pan holds 5.4 litres of oil. This increase from the standard 4.2 litres provides an extra layer of security, ensuring the engine remains well-lubricated even in extreme conditions.

Option 2: Ultra High Capacity Oil Pan holds 7.1 litres of oil, which is essential for older, high-mileage engines prone to oil consumption. This option helps prevent oil starvation, a common issue in older engines.

Ground Clearance Advantages

One of the significant benefits of upgrading to a high-capacity oil pan is improved ground clearance. In vehicle conversions, especially with lowered vehicles or off-road setups, ground clearance is vital.

The Increased Ground Clearance Oil Pan has a height of 110 mm, while the Ultra High Capacity Oil Pan stands at 147 mm. They both offer more clearance than the stock 168 mm in height.

Superior Cooling And Durability

High-capacity oil pans often have advanced features to enhance engine cooling and durability. For example, the Specialised Parts oil pans include:

  • Cooling fins: These are cast into the oil pan to help dissipate heat more effectively, keeping oil temperatures stable even during intense driving conditions.
  • Strengthening ribs: These are engineered into the oil pan’s sidewalls to provide additional durability, preventing warping or damage under stress.

The Importance of Oil Pressure Sensors for Subaru EJ253 Engines

Preventing Cylinder Head Damage

One of the most common issues in Subaru EJ253 engines is cracking the cylinder head due to over-tightening the oil pressure sensor. This problem can be devastating, leading to thousands of dollars in repairs.

However, with a product like Specialised Parts’ oil pressure sensor, you can solve the issue quickly and without removing the head. This repair kit is a game-changer for those looking to save time and money.

The kit includes everything you need to repair the cylinder head and reinstall the oil pressure sensor safely. From the repair insert to the drill stop, the kit is designed to repair as smoothly and efficiently as possible.

How the Oil Pressure Sensor/Sender Repair Kit Works

The oil pressure sensor from Specialised Parts is designed specifically for the Subaru EJ253 engine. It addresses the common issue of cracking the cylinder head due to over-tightening the oil pressure sensor.

The kit allows you to repair the damaged area without removing the engine or the cylinder head, saving you time and money. Here’s how it works:

  • Repair Insert: This small but essential piece fits into the damaged area. It restores the connection for the oil pressure sensor without needing extensive engine disassembly.
  • Drill and Drill Stop: These tools allow for precise drilling into the damaged area without risking further harm to the cylinder head.
  • Tap: This tool helps create the threads needed for the repair insert to sit securely in place.
  • Step-by-Step Instructions: With clear instructions and colour photographs, the kit makes the repair process accessible, even for those with basic mechanical skills.

Tools You’ll Need

Depending on the side of the engine you’re working on, you’ll need different tools:

For the passenger side head, you only need basic hand tools, a drill, and an extension.

For the driver-side head, you’ll need to remove more components such as the timing belt, tensioner, and cam gear; it requires a higher level of mechanical expertise.

Common Signs Of Oil Leaking From The Cylinder Head

Spotting oil leaks early can prevent significant engine damage. Here are some common signs to watch for:

Oil Spots Under Your Vehicle

One of the most obvious signs of an oil leak is finding oil spots or puddles under your vehicle. If you notice this, inspect your engine to determine if the leak is coming from the cylinder head.

Smoke From The Exhaust Area

Oil leaking from a cracked cylinder head oil pressure sender port will typically drip down the side of the cylinder head onto the exhaust manifold and then cause smoke and noxious fumes.

Overheating Engine

Oil leaks can cause the engine to overheat by reducing the effectiveness of the cooling system. If your engine frequently overheats, it could be due to oil leaking from the cylinder head.

Low Oil Levels

Regularly checking your oil levels can help you spot leaks early. If you notice that your oil levels are consistently low, it might be due to a leak from the cylinder head.

Diagnosing The Cause Of The Leak

Identifying the signs of an oil leak is just the first step. Next, you need to diagnose the underlying cause. Here are some common reasons why oil might be leaking from your cylinder head: Worn Cylinder Head Gasket

The cylinder head gasket seals the cylinder head to the engine block. Over time, it can wear out or get damaged, leading to oil leaks. A blown gasket is a common culprit behind oil leaks from the cylinder head.

Cracked Cylinder Head

A cracked cylinder head can allow oil to seep out. Cracks can result from overheating or manufacturing defects. If you suspect a crack, it is time to replace the sender and install our Oil Pressure Sender Repair Kit.

Faulty Valve Cover Gasket

The valve cover gasket sits on top of the cylinder head and prevents oil from leaking out. If this gasket is damaged or worn, it can cause oil to leak from the cylinder head.

Key Components For Servicing

High-Efficiency Compressors

The compressor is the heart of your AC system. Servicing high-efficiency compressors can significantly improve cooling performance and durability. Look for models specifically designed for Subaru vehicles to ensure compatibility and optimal performance.

Advanced Condensers

The condenser helps convert refrigerant from gas to liquid. Modern condensers with larger surface areas can dissipate heat more effectively, resulting in cooler air inside the vehicle. Cleaning and checking the condenser to ensure it remains free of obstacles ensures better heat transference.

Improved Evaporators Efficiency

The evaporator absorbs heat from the cabin, providing cool air. Servicing the evaporator can enhance the cooling efficiency and speed of your AC system.

Receiver-Driers/Accumulators Servicing

These components remove moisture from the refrigerant. Servicing ensures a more efficient unit can prevent moisture buildup and ensure a longer lifespan for your AC system.
